Eden Gardens is a venue that RCB and their fans will remember quite vividly. It is on this ground that Virat Kohli scored his last IPL century in 2019. And this is where he collapsed for just 49 runs in 2017.

KKR coach Chandrakant Pandit is taking the team’s loss to PBKS in Mohali as a positive. “I am looking at it in a very positive way. The way the team performed, we stayed in the game till the end despite losing back-to-back wickets. The guys showed their character to stay in the game. With this positivity we are going into the next match.

“One cannot be judgmental after just the first game. Looking at our last game, we were in it till the end. I have full faith in the side we have.”

He also felt that KKR is not short of experience. “I would not say there is a lack of experience. Each one has created an impact both domestically and internationally. They are all distinguished cricketers,” said Pandit.

KKR have included Jason Roy in the squad in place of their first choice captain Shreyas Iyer. “We will miss two players. Roy is a top-order batsman and can be used as an impact player.
